Authorities have named the bomber responsible for the Manchester attacks as Salman Abedi, 22 years old. He was killed in the blast that claimed the lives of 22 people and injured dozens more. As of now there are only three confirmed identifications of those murdered: eight-year-old Saffie Rose Roussos, 18-year-old Georgina Callander, and 28-year-old John Atkinson. A statement from Theresa May said that “many” children had been killed, with reports suggesting that as many as twelve of the victims were under the age of 16.
“We struggle to comprehend the warped and twisted mind that sees a room packed with young children not as a scene to cherish but an opportunity for carnage," May said after being called to an emergency meeting regarding the tragedy.
